How can I use a Find/Replace operation to insert a filename (or better, the first n characters of a filename) into that same file? That is, I want to open a (html) file, go to a certain point, insert the file's name (or part of it) and then go on to the next file in that directory and do it all over again (using a new filename, of course). I have 600 files to process, and doing it manually is not feasible. I know how to do a "global" Find/Replace over all these files, but I need a token of some kind to insert the filename. Or a clip to do the same, operating over all 600 files. Can this be done? [Hints to a better subsection of the forum for this query are welcome.] Thanks. Collier Smith |
